Remember to follow all safety precautions before starting any work on your … Webb22 feb. 2024 · The U-3 is a bit on the large side for that CID. With a cold engine, it needs the hand throttle opened about 1/4 of the way and pull full choke so that it is nearly flooding to start. But, the instant the engine fires the choke handle must be quickly pushed in about 3/4 of the way. The 29 135 motor is the same CID but uses a smaller Venturi carb.

Webb9 juli 2010 · 2. Posted: Jun 2, 2024. Options. A small engine like that that idles ok but bogs under acceleration is usually one of three things; 1) air leak at the intake boot. A squirt of starter fluid at the boot while running will tell you. If it revs you have a vacuum leak. Webb6 apr. 2024 · 2. Too Much Fuel. If you get too much fuel in the combustion chamber, your engine won’t be able to start. Remember that a 2 stroke engine burns a fuel mixture of gas and air, so if too much gas gets into the chamber, the spark plug won’t be able to make enough of a spark to ignite the fuel mixture. Webb9 maj 2024 · Now, for easy starting it’s best to have the lowend a little rich and it will four-stroke a little. Pop-off Pressure. Walbro carburetors should have a pop-off pressure of between 10 and 14 psi. Go here for how to change pop-off pressure.
